> 2007-02-14 Sandra Loosemore <sandra@codesourcery.com>
> Brooks Moses <brooks.moses@codesourcery.com>
> Lee Millward <lee.millward@codesourcery.com>
>
> * trans-expr.c (gfc_conv_power_op): Use build_call_expr.
> (gfc_conv_string_tmp): Likewise.
> (gfc_conv_concat_op): Likewise.
> (gfc_build_compare_string): Likewise.
> (gfc_conv_function_call): Use build_call_list instead of build3.
>
> * trans-array.c (gfc_trans_allocate_array_storage): Use
> build_call_expr.
> (gfc_grow_array): Likewise.
> (gfc_trans_array_ctor_element): Likewise.
> (gfc_trans_array_constructor_value): Likewise.
> (gfc_array_allocate): Likewise.
> (gfc_array_deallocate): Likewise.
> (gfc_trans_auto_array_allocation): Likewise.
> (gfc_trans_dummy_array_bias): Likewise.
> (gfc_conv_array_parameter): Likewise.
> (gfc_trans_dealloc_allocated): Likewise.
> (gfc_duplicate_allocatable): Likewise.
>
> * trans-openmp.c (gfc_trans_omp_barrier): Use build_call_expr.
> (gfc_trans_omp_flush): Likewise.
>
> * trans-stmt.c (gfc_conv_elementel_dependencies): Use build_call_expr.
> (gfc_trans_pause): Likewise.
> (gfc_trans_stop): Likewise.
> (gfc_trans_character_select): Likewise.
> (gfc_do_allocate): Likewise.
> (gfc_trans_assign_need_temp): Likewise.
> (gfc_trans_pointer_assign_need_temp): Likewise.
> (gfc_trans_forall_1): Likewise.
> (gfc_trans_where_2): Likewise.
> (gfc_trans_allocate): Likewise.
> (gfc_trans_deallocate): Likewise.
>
> * trans.c (gfc_trans_runtime_check): Use build_call_expr.
>
> * trans-io.c (gfc_trans_open): Use build_call_expr.
> (gfc_trans_close): Likewise.
> (build_filepos): Likewise.
> (gfc_trans_inquire): Likewise.
> (NML_FIRST_ARG): Delete.
> (NML_ADD_ARG): Delete.
> (transfer_namelist_element): Use build_call_expr.
> (build_dt): Likewise.
> (gfc_trans_dt_end): Likewise.
> (transfer_expr): Likewise.
> (transfer_array-desc): Likewise.
>
> * trans-decl.c (gfc_generate_function_code): Use build_call_expr.
> (gfc_generate_constructors): Likewise.
>
> * trans-intrinsic.c (gfc_conv_intrinsic_ctime): Use build_call_expr.
> (gfc_conv_intrinsic_fdate): Likewise.
> (gfc_conv_intrinsic_ttynam): Likewise.
> (gfc_conv_intrinsic_array_transfer): Likewise.
> (gfc_conv_associated): Likewise.
> (gfc_conv_intrinsic_si_kind): Likewise.
> (gfc_conv_intrinsic_trim): Likewise.
> (gfc_conv_intrinsic_repeat: Likewise.
> (gfc_conv_intrinsic_iargc): Likewise.
>
